VPS侦探论坛

 找回密码
 注册
查看: 4559|回复: 3

军哥,如何让html文件按php处理啊

[复制链接]
发表于 2014-6-21 14:13:55 | 显示全部楼层 |阅读模式

网上找了一些方法,实验了不行

有两种方式修改nginx配置文件可以实现。方式一:打开你的网站的nginx配置文件,然后找到:“location ~ .php$ {”,再把其中的.php修改为:“.php|.html”,保存后重启nginx即可。方式二:同上,打开配置文件找到:“location ~ .php$ {”,然后把location整段复制,在下面粘帖上,再把.php修改为.html,保存后重启nginx即可生效。上述两种方式的配置示例代码如下:location ~ .php|.html$ { fastcgi_pass 127.0.0.1:9000; fastcgi_index index.php; fastcgi_param SCRIPT_FILENAME /webs$fastcgi_script_name; include fastcgi_params; }示例代码二:location ~ .html$ { fastcgi_pass 127.0.0.1:9000; fastcgi_index index.php; fastcgi_param SCRIPT_FILENAME /webs$fastcgi_script_name; include fastcgi_params; }


补充下:我按上面的执行了,现在ip/myphpadmin/都打不开了,提示500错误,当然也不确定是上述操作影响的,今天进行了很多操作
谢谢

[ 本帖最后由 游侠 于 2014-6-21 14:29 编辑 ]
美国VPS推荐: 遨游主机LinodeLOCVPS主机云搬瓦工80VPSVultr美国VPS主机中国VPS推荐: 阿里云腾讯云。LNMP付费服务(代装/问题排查)QQ 503228080
发表于 2014-6-21 14:33:58 | 显示全部楼层


配置别从网上整些没用
看lnmp的nginx.conf不就行了

你是不是想弄伪静态?
Linux下Nginx+MySQL+PHP自动安装工具:https://lnmp.org
 楼主| 发表于 2014-6-21 14:37:22 | 显示全部楼层

感谢军哥回复,我的不是伪静态,是真静态,比如http://www.baidu.com/123.html,这个123.html文件是真实存在根目录的,里面包有php命令
美国VPS推荐: 遨游主机LinodeLOCVPS主机云搬瓦工80VPSVultr美国VPS主机中国VPS推荐: 阿里云腾讯云。LNMP付费服务(代装/问题排查)QQ 503228080
 楼主| 发表于 2014-6-21 17:33:26 | 显示全部楼层



问题搞定了,有个地方没解开限制
Linux下Nginx+MySQL+PHP自动安装工具:https://lnmp.org
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|VPS侦探 ( 鲁ICP备16040043号-1 )

GMT+8, 2024-9-25 21:28 , Processed in 0.025234 second(s), 16 queries .

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表